For thy Maker is thine husband; the LORD of hosts is his name; and thy Redeemer the Holy One of Israel; The God of the whole earth shall he be called.

General references

Bible References

Thy maker

Psalm 45:10
Hearken, O daughter, and consider; incline thine ear. Forget also thine own people, and thy father's house.
Jeremiah 3:14
O ye shrinking children, turn again, sayeth the LORD: and I will be married with you. For I will take one out of the city, and two out of one generation from among you, and bring you out of Zion:
Ezekiel 16:8
Now when I went by thee, and looked upon thee: behold, thy time was come; yea, even the time to vow thee. Then spread I my clothes over thee, to cover thy dishonesty: Yea, I made an oath unto thee, and married myself with thee, sayeth the LORD God; and so thou becamest mine own.
Hosea 2:19
Thus will I marry thee unto mine own self forevermore: yea even to myself will I marry thee, in righteousness, in equity, in loving-kindness, and mercy.
John 3:29
He that hath the bride is the bridegroom: But the friend of the bridegroom which standeth by and heareth him, rejoiceth greatly of the bridegroom's voice. Therefore this, my joy, is fulfilled.
2 Corinthians 11:2
For I am jealous over you with godly jealousy. For I coupled you to one man, to make you a chaste virgin to Christ:
Ephesians 5:25
Husbands: love your wives, even as Christ loved the congregation, and gave himself for it,
